Tripoli Port receives Kone Crane-type grab from Turkish branch of Portunus

Summary by Libya Herald
Tripoli Port reported yesterday that a joint technical team from the Libyan Ports Company’s head office and its Tripoli Port branch, led by technicians from the Turkish supplier, Portunus, begun assembling and installing the new Kone Crane-type grab, which recently arrived from head office.
